Illinois Pioneers AI Regulation: A Bold Leap or a Bureaucratic Maze?
Illinois has officially stepped into the future, enacting groundbreaking legislation aimed at overseeing artificial intelligence. This move positions the state as a trailblazer in the complex and rapidly evolving landscape of AI governance, seeking to establish ethical frameworks and consumer protections in an era increasingly defined by algorithmic decision-making. The law's passage marks a significant milestone, reflecting a growing global recognition of the need to regulate AI's powerful, yet often opaque, capabilities.
The legislative intent behind Illinois' new AI oversight law is clear: to mitigate potential harms associated with AI, such as algorithmic bias, privacy infringements, and lack of transparency. Advocates for the bill envision a future where AI systems deployed within the state are more accountable, equitable, and understandable to the public they serve. This proactive approach aims to foster responsible innovation while safeguarding individual rights and public trust, setting a precedent that other states and even federal agencies may eventually follow.
However, the journey from legislative decree to effective implementation is rarely straightforward, especially with a technology as dynamic and multifaceted as artificial intelligence. Experts and stakeholders are already raising pertinent questions about the practicalities of enforcing such a law. Defining 'AI' itself within a legal context presents a monumental challenge, as the technology continuously evolves and branches into new applications. Furthermore, the state will need to grapple with a myriad of operational hurdles, including the allocation of sufficient resources, the recruitment and training of specialized technical personnel for oversight roles, and the development of robust, scalable compliance mechanisms.
The rapid pace of AI development also complicates regulatory efforts. Laws enacted today could become quickly outdated by tomorrow's technological advancements, demanding a flexible and adaptive regulatory framework that can evolve in lockstep with innovation. There are also concerns about potential regulatory overlaps or conflicts with future federal guidelines or existing sector-specific regulations. Businesses operating across state lines might face a patchwork of differing rules, creating compliance complexities.
Ultimately, the success of Illinois' pioneering AI oversight law will hinge not just on its well-intentioned objectives, but on its capacity for practical execution. The coming months and years will be critical as the state navigates these uncharted waters, demonstrating whether it can effectively translate its bold legislative vision into tangible protections and foster a truly responsible AI ecosystem. The world will be watching to see if Illinois can indeed provide a viable blueprint for ethical AI governance.
